Why do you want to come to Bashang for photography in winter?

1. One mountain, one water, one grass and one tree here are all beautiful. If you catch up with the snow, you can create a beautiful dynamic and static photography effect. The snowflakes splashed in the snow all show the majestic momentum of the scene, gathering in the flying cattle and sheep, the smoke and fences of the villages after the snow, and the undulating lines are either frustrated or uplifted, which has a distinct sense of rhythm and rhythm to the visual impact.

2. show up sooner or later? Riel? The top of the mountain overlooks the snow-covered grassland, and the backlight or side backlight captures the texture of snow, the ice surface of the lake after snow, the trestle, the wooden house in the forest, the footprints of cattle, sheep and horses in the snow, the footprints of people, the snow-covered streams and towers.

3. The grassland in winter is not only quiet, the terrain is changeable, the landscape is natural and there are few people. Only the photographer who gets up early walks in the snow with a tripod, which is also a scene in the picture, which is very suitable for creation.

The following is the best route for winter photography in Bashang:

D 1 Beijing Collection D2 Beijing? Royal Imperial Road in Beijing? Wulanbu series? Xiaohetou Sunset Photography Theme: Xiaohetou Sunset (Sunset)

You can leave around 7: 00 in the morning, follow the "southbound ramble" and the Royal Imperial Road in Beijing, and go to Mulan paddock and photography base. Then drive to different scenic spots in Ulan, which has both the beauty of the south and the beauty of the north. Finally, I stopped at the source of a white river 6 kilometers away and had a fairyland-like encounter with the beautiful rime.

D3 Aobao vomits at sunrise? Aobao spits snow? Film and television base? Horse stepping on snow? Sunset photography theme in Beigou: Aobaotu (sunrise), Mata Xue Fei, Toufenggou, Nanjing and Beigou (sunset).

Set out at 6: 00 in the morning, take the shooting equipment and rush to Aobaotu to enjoy the sunrise in Aobaotu. In the afternoon 14, take a cross-country ride to experience the thrill of flying in the snow and go to the film and television base. In the afternoon 15, I went to Beigou Scenic Area. Because it runs north and south, it is very suitable for shooting cattle, sheep and green grass in Toufenggou and Nanjing at dusk. Follow the experienced guide, make rational use of the dusk time on the winter dam, and finally record the sunset in Beigou, which can be painted horizontally or vertically.

D4 Baijiawopu Sunrise? Recreational activities in Snow Country? Sika deer park? Panorama of the dam? The sky is so beautiful? Themes of sunset photography: Baijiawopu (sunrise), Toad Dam and Tiantai Yong.

At 6 o'clock in the morning, head for Baijiawopu, and then 13: 30, drive on the terrain of two mountains and one ditch and rush to Toad Dam. Large and medium-sized scenes can be shot at the top of the dam, and small and medium-sized scenes can be shot at the bottom of the ditch. There are herds and river fences at the bottom of the ditch, which constitute an idyllic scenery. You can also shoot "China is too Yong" to graze cattle and sheep in Baer until sunset.

/kloc-sunrise at camp 0/2? Jinshanling Great Wall Sunset Sunset Photography Theme: Jinshanling Great Wall (Sunset)

Go to 12 at 6 o'clock in the morning to enjoy the sunrise, then take a bus to Jinshanling Great Wall, and arrive at Jinshanling Great Wall in the afternoon to shoot the unique scenery of Jinshan and watch the afterglow of the sunset. Jinshanling Great Wall is located in Luanping County, Chengde City, Hebei Province, adjacent to Miyun County, Beijing. It is the best preserved section of the Great Wall of Ming Dynasty, which is the essence.

D6 Sunrise and morning fog at Jinshanling Great Wall? Beijing Photography Theme: Jinshanling Great Wall (Sunrise)

If there is no particularly thick fog, we will leave around 6 am and return to Jinshanling Great Wall to shoot the sunrise. I will return to Beijing around 8 o'clock, and the journey will take about 4 hours. Arrived in Beijing in the afternoon 12, ending a pleasant journey.
